Sunrise, Sunset
 
Dark shadows pull at the light,
Light layered over deepest night,
Night that shall forever fight,
Fight all that is true and right.
 
Faint dots blaze in a dark sky,
Sky that watches sunshine die,
Die to be born, dawn draws nigh,
Nigh to those who want to fly.
 
Dark gives birth to new day,
Day will chase the dark away,
Away to return, edged with gray,
Gray the borders, here to stay.
 
Sunrise to sunset, ever on,
On to be conquered by the dawn,
Dawn to die by darkest spawn,
Spawn to lose but never gone.
